Residential Rehabilitation

DSW has extensive experience completing residential rehabilitations and emergency repairs for homes impacted by disasters. For properties that remain structurally suitable for repair, our team addresses the specific damage identified during inspection, including roofing, electrical, plumbing, HVAC, drywall, flooring, windows, doors, and other critical components.

Home Elevations

DSW brings deep, hands‑on expertise in elevating flood‑damaged homes through elevation‑focused CDBG‑DR and CDBG‑MIT programs in high‑risk flood zones. We specialize exclusively in raising existing residential structures following flood events, collaborating closely with state housing agencies, disaster recovery offices, counties, and local governments to deliver compliant, resilient outcomes.

Reconstruction

DSW has extensive experience delivering full residential reconstruction services for homes that have been severely damaged or destroyed by disasters. When a property qualifies for reconstruction, our team manages the entire process from start to finish, including demolition of the existing structure, site preparation, permitting, new home construction, inspections, and final homeowner turnover.
